import * as vscode from "vscode";
import { AtelierAPI } from "../api";
import { loadChanges } from "../commands/compile";
import { StudioActions } from "../commands/studio";
import { clsLangId, cspApps } from "../extension";
import { currentFile, outputChannel } from "../utils";
/**
* The URI strings for all documents that are open in a custom editor.
*/
export const openCustomEditors: string[] = [];
export class RuleEditorProvider implements vscode.CustomTextEditorProvider {
private static readonly _webapp: string = "/ui/interop/rule-editor";
private static _errorMessage(detail: string) {
return vscode.window
.showErrorMessage("Cannot open Rule Editor.", {
modal: true,
detail,
})
.then(() => vscode.commands.executeCommand<void>("workbench.action.toggleEditorType"));
}
async resolveCustomTextEditor(
document: vscode.TextDocument,
webviewPanel: vscode.WebviewPanel,
token: vscode.CancellationToken
): Promise<void> {
// Check that document is a clean, well-formed class
if (document.languageId != clsLangId) {
return RuleEditorProvider._errorMessage(`${document.fileName} is not a class.`);
}
if (document.isUntitled) {
return RuleEditorProvider._errorMessage(`${document.fileName} is untitled.`);
}
if (document.isDirty) {
return RuleEditorProvider._errorMessage(`${document.fileName} is dirty.`);
}
const file = currentFile(document);
if (file == null) {
return RuleEditorProvider._errorMessage(`${document.fileName} is a malformed class definition.`);
}
const className = file.name.slice(0, -4);
const api = new AtelierAPI(document.uri);
const documentUriString = document.uri.toString();
// Check that the server has the webapp for the angular rule editor
const cspAppsKey = `${api.serverId}:%SYS`.toLowerCase();
let sysCspApps: string[] | undefined = cspApps.get(cspAppsKey);
if (sysCspApps == undefined) {
sysCspApps = await api.getCSPApps(false, "%SYS").then((data) => data.result.content || []);
cspApps.set(cspAppsKey, sysCspApps);
}
if (!sysCspApps.includes(RuleEditorProvider._webapp)) {
return RuleEditorProvider._errorMessage(`Server '${api.serverId}' does not support the Angular Rule Editor.`);
}
// Check that the class exists on the server and is a rule class
const queryData = await api.actionQuery("SELECT Super FROM %Dictionary.ClassDefinition WHERE Name = ?", [
className,
]);
if (
queryData.result.content.length &&
!queryData.result.content[0].Super.split(",").includes("Ens.Rule.Definition")
) {
// Class exists but is not a rule class
return RuleEditorProvider._errorMessage(`${className} is not a rule definition class.`);
} else if (queryData.result.content.length == 0) {
// Class doesn't exist on the server
return RuleEditorProvider._errorMessage(`Class ${className} does not exist on the server.`);
}
// Add this document to the array of open custom editors
openCustomEditors.push(documentUriString);
// Initialize the webview
const targetOrigin = `${api.config.https ? "https" : "http"}://${api.config.host}:${api.config.port}`;
const iframeUri = `${targetOrigin}${api.config.pathPrefix}${
RuleEditorProvider._webapp
}/index.html?$NAMESPACE=${api.config.ns.toUpperCase()}&VSCODE=1&rule=${className}`;
webviewPanel.webview.options = {
enableScripts: true,
localResourceRoots: [],
};
webviewPanel.webview.html = `
<!DOCTYPE html>
<html lang="en">
<head>
<style type="text/css">
body, html {
margin: 0; padding: 0; height: 100%; overflow: hidden;
background-color: white;
}
#content {
position:absolute; left: 0; right: 0; bottom: 0; top: 0px;
}
</style>
</head>
<body>
<div id="content">
<iframe id="editor" title="Rule Editor" src="${iframeUri}" width="100%" height="100%" frameborder="0"></iframe>
</div>
<script>
(function() {
const vscode = acquireVsCodeApi();
const iframe = document.getElementById('editor');
iframe.onload = () => {
// Tell VS Code to check if the editor is compatible
vscode.postMessage({ type: "loaded" });
}
window.onmessage = (event) => {
const data = event.data;
if (data.direction == 'editor') {
iframe.contentWindow.postMessage(data, '${targetOrigin}');
}
else if (data.direction == 'vscode') {
vscode.postMessage(data);
}
}
}())
</script>
</body>
</html>
`;
// Initialize event handlers
let ignoreChanges = false;
let documentWasDirty = false;
let editorCompatible = false;
const contentDisposable = vscode.workspace.onDidChangeTextDocument((event) => {
if (documentUriString == event.document.uri.toString()) {
if (event.reason == vscode.TextDocumentChangeReason.Undo) {
if (ignoreChanges) {
ignoreChanges = false;
} else {
// User invoked undo
webviewPanel.webview.postMessage({
direction: "editor",
type: "undo",
});
ignoreChanges = true;
vscode.commands.executeCommand("redo");
}
} else if (event.reason == vscode.TextDocumentChangeReason.Redo) {
if (ignoreChanges) {
ignoreChanges = false;
} else {
// User invoked redo
webviewPanel.webview.postMessage({
direction: "editor",
type: "redo",
});
ignoreChanges = true;
vscode.commands.executeCommand("undo");
}
} else if (!ignoreChanges && !event.document.isDirty && documentWasDirty) {
// User reverted the file
webviewPanel.webview.postMessage({
direction: "editor",
type: "revert",
});
}
documentWasDirty = event.document.isDirty;
}
});
const saveDisposable = vscode.workspace.onDidSaveTextDocument((savedDocument) => {
if (documentUriString == savedDocument.uri.toString()) {
// User saved the file
webviewPanel.webview.postMessage({
direction: "editor",
type: "save",
});
}
});
webviewPanel.webview.onDidReceiveMessage((event) => {
switch (event.type) {
case "compatible":
editorCompatible = true;
return;
case "badrule":
RuleEditorProvider._errorMessage(event.reason);
return;
case "loaded":
if (!editorCompatible) {
RuleEditorProvider._errorMessage(
"This server's Angular Rule Editor does not support embedding in VS Code."
);
} else {
// Editor is compatible so send the credentials
webviewPanel.webview.postMessage({
direction: "editor",
type: "auth",
username: api.config.username,
password: api.config.password,
});
}
return;
case "changed":
if (event.dirty && !document.isDirty) {
// Make a trivial edit so the document appears dirty
const edit = new vscode.WorkspaceEdit();
edit.insert(document.uri, document.lineAt(document.lineCount - 1).range.end, " ");
vscode.workspace.applyEdit(edit);
} else if (!event.dirty && document.isDirty) {
// Revert so document is clean
ignoreChanges = true;
vscode.commands.executeCommand("workbench.action.files.revert");
}
return;
case "saved":
if (document.isDirty) {
// Revert so document is clean
ignoreChanges = true;
vscode.commands.executeCommand("workbench.action.files.revert");
}
if (vscode.workspace.getConfiguration("objectscript", document.uri).get<boolean>("compileOnSave")) {
// User requests a post-save compile
webviewPanel.webview.postMessage({
direction: "editor",
type: "compile",
});
} else {
// Load changes
loadChanges([file]);
}
return;
case "compiled":
if (document.isDirty) {
// Revert so document is clean
ignoreChanges = true;
vscode.commands.executeCommand("workbench.action.files.revert");
}
// Load changes
loadChanges([file]);
return;
case "userAction": {
// Process the source control user action
// Should only be action 2 (show web page)
new StudioActions(document.uri).processUserAction(event.action).then((answer) => {
if (answer) {
api
.actionQuery("SELECT * FROM %Atelier_v1_Utils.Extension_AfterUserAction(?,?,?,?,?)", [
"0",
event.id,
file.name,
answer,
"",
])
.then((data) => {
if (data.result.content.length) {
const actionToProcess = data.result.content.pop();
if (actionToProcess.reload) {
// Revert so document is clean
ignoreChanges = true;
vscode.commands.executeCommand("workbench.action.files.revert");
// Tell the rule editor to reload
webviewPanel.webview.postMessage({
direction: "editor",
type: "revert",
});
}
if (actionToProcess.errorText !== "") {
outputChannel.appendLine(
`\nError executing AfterUserAction '${event.label}':\n${actionToProcess.errorText}`
);
outputChannel.show();
}
}
})
.catch((error) => {
outputChannel.appendLine(`\nError executing AfterUserAction '${event.label}':`);
if (error && error.errorText && error.errorText !== "") {
outputChannel.appendLine(error.errorText);
} else {
outputChannel.appendLine(
typeof error == "string" ? error : error instanceof Error ? error.message : JSON.stringify(error)
);
}
outputChannel.show();
});
}
});
return;
}
}
});
webviewPanel.onDidDispose(() => {
contentDisposable.dispose();
saveDisposable.dispose();
if (document.isDirty) {
// Revert so document is clean
vscode.commands.executeCommand("workbench.action.files.revert");
}
const idx = openCustomEditors.findIndex((elem) => elem == documentUriString);
if (idx >= 0) {
// Remove this document from the array of open custom editors
openCustomEditors.splice(idx, 1);
}
});
}
}
